
What color shirt should you wear for a passport photo?
DO consider wearing a color other than black or white. Your photo will have a plain white background, so a colored shirt will help ensure your photo doesn't look washed out.

Can I wear earrings in visa photo?
Photographs that show only a portion of the chin or have a portion of the head cut off will not be accepted. Both ears must be totally visible, free of hair or other covering. Earrings should not be worn, unless they are small, post earrings, and do not cover any part of the ears.
Can you wear black in a passport photo?
Officially, no rules about the colors you wear for your passport photo exist. The U.S. government will not reject a passport application because of your color of clothing in the photo.

How should I dress for a passport photo?
Passport photos are not the place to make fashion statements. The State Department wants your photo to be "taken in clothing normally worn on a daily basis." However, no uniforms, or clothing that looks like a uniform, or camouflage clothing is allowed. You also can't wear a hat or head covering in your photo.
Can you wear white in a passport photo?
Wear a Color Other Than White Your passport photo must have a plain white background, so if you wear a white shirt, it may blend into the background and leave you looking like a floating head.

Can I smile in US visa photo?
When having their photos captured, applicant may smile, but without showing their teeth and gums. The 'Mona Lisa' smile is recommended. Eyeglasses should always be removed before capturing the applicant's photo.
Can I wear my hair in a ponytail for a passport photo?
What it means is that you are free to have your hair in a ponytail or wear it up in a bun. However, it is advisable to keep your hair organized, as your good look is not the key aspect of passport photographs, and some officers might consider unusual hairstyles at odds with passport photo rules.

Is there a dress code in DFA?
The DFA enforces a strict dress code, which prohibits wearing spaghetti straps, sando, plunging neckline, sleeveless top, tube top, halter top, and see-through top. Colored contact lenses, eyeglasses, and accessories like earrings, necklaces, or other facial piercings must be removed during photo capturing.
